      Wages for Tellers in MONTANA

      Location Pay
      Period
      2024
      10% 25% Median 75% 90%
      United States Hourly $15.04 $17.51 $18.91 $21.90 $23.21
      Yearly $31,270 $36,420 $39,340 $45,550 $48,270
      Montana Hourly $16.12 $17.35 $18.10 $19.49 $21.69
      Yearly $33,530 $36,080 $37,640 $40,540 $45,110
      Bozeman, MT Metro Area Hourly $18.02 $18.53 $20.36 $21.62 $22.34
      Yearly $37,480 $38,550 $42,350 $44,970 $46,460
      Southwest Montana Balance of State Hourly $15.46 $16.92 $18.28 $18.91 $21.02
      Yearly $32,150 $35,200 $38,020 $39,340 $43,730
      East-Central Montana Balance of State Hourly $15.07 $17.07 $18.24 $18.84 $21.98
      Yearly $31,340 $35,510 $37,930 $39,190 $45,720
      West Montana Balance of State Hourly $16.38 $17.36 $18.19 $19.08 $20.78
      Yearly $34,070 $36,100 $37,830 $39,680 $43,210
      Billings, MT Metro Area Hourly $17.06 $17.59 $18.03 $19.33 $21.69
      Yearly $35,490 $36,600 $37,510 $40,210 $45,110
      Helena, MT Metro Area Hourly $16.89 $17.43 $18.00 $18.81 $21.49
      Yearly $35,140 $36,260 $37,440 $39,130 $44,700
      Missoula, MT Metro Area Hourly $16.60 $17.02 $17.82 $19.45 $22.27
      Yearly $34,530 $35,400 $37,070 $40,460 $46,320
      Great Falls, MT Metro Area Hourly $15.15 $16.50 $17.22 $19.28 $21.49
      Yearly $31,520 $34,320 $35,810 $40,100 $44,710
